What They Do

E.ON focuses on renewable energy, including wind and solar power, energy storage systems, smart grids, and hydrogen production. The company offers a variety of products and services, including electricity and gas supply, maintenance of energy networks, and solutions for electromobility. E.ON serves customers in Europe, particularly in Germany, the United Kingdom, Sweden, and Turkey, providing comprehensive energy management from production to consulting (source: bitscale.ai). Target markets include both private households and businesses, with innovative products like the E.ON Next Gen Home, which combines solar energy and heat pumps (source: eonnext.com). E.ON differentiates itself through its 61 GW of generation capacity, which is focused on renewable energy following the separation from conventional businesses (source: energy-storage.news).

Projects & Achievements

E.ON has completed a variety of notable projects, including the integration of 3,000 to 3,500 residential storage systems in Germany. The company operates extensive energy networks in Europe and has research collaborations such as the E.ON Energy Research Center at RWTH Aachen, which employs over 150 scientists (source: company-histories.com). Ongoing major projects include the cross-border district heating supply for Zgorzelec (Poland) and Görlitz (Germany), as well as the HDV-E project for the electrification of heavy vehicles, which has secured EU funding (source: eon.com). E.ON is also working on further developing the E.ON Next Gen Home, which is set to roll out in the UK by 2026 (source: eonnext.com).

Job Description

As (Senior) Trading Operations and Flexibility Specialist in our ST Flex and Algorithmic Trading Team, you are an integral part of growing our BESS and flexible asset portfolio. You ensure front-to-end process readiness for flexibility trading across commodity and TSO markets and establish best-in-class processes and data flows within E.ON's short-term operations. You shape the further development of our operational and technical capabilities within short-term trading and manage projects, processes and partners alike. Your responsibilities include:

  • You engage with internal and external stakeholders to ensure integration of flexible assets into E.ON's short term trading portfolio;
  • You ensure front-2-end business readiness in our system and process landscape and by managing implementation projects;
  • You act as business owner for our trading systems and define business requirements, in particular for algorithmic trading, market access, deal capture, and scheduling;
  • You design and coordinate short-term market access solutions and services with partners and set-up and manage trading-related contracts;
  • You take ownership for enhancing our operational and technical capabilities for short-term trading and implement new business logic, automate processes, and modernize systems;
  • You ensure data quality for accurate P&L and performance monitoring and to gain insights for the continuous improvement of algorithmic trading and optimization capabilities.

Qualifications

  • You have a university degree in energy economics, information systems, engineering, natural sciences or comparable studies;
  • You have at least 3 years of experience with trading systems and operational processes in a trading environment and experience with setting up business processes and coordinating IT developments;
  • You have professional experience in energy trading and an excellent understanding of the German Day Ahead, Intraday and ancillary service markets;
  • You have an inner drive to continuously improve our trading processes and capabilities and to leave your footprint on the future setup;
  • You are an entrepreneurial individual with a strong analytical and commercial attitude that wants to take responsibility for the growth and success of our flexibility and short-term trading;
  • You are a team player with strong communication and collaboration skills and can navigate between interests of a diverse set of internal and external stakeholders;
  • You have excellent spoken and written communication skills in English; good command of German is seen as a plus.
